EDITORS COMMENTS
In this photo print, titled "The Private Conversation". Jean Beraud skillfully captures a moment of secrecy and intimacy. Painted in 1904, the oil on canvas artwork depicts a clandestine encounter between a male and female figure within the confines of a dimly lit room. The couple is engaged in an intense conversation while playing cards, their faces reflecting both concentration and emotion. Beraud's mastery lies in his ability to convey the complexity of human relationships through subtle gestures and expressions. The downcast eyes of both individuals suggest an argument or disagreement, adding an air of tension to the scene. Their body language speaks volumes about their connection - they are physically close yet emotionally distant. This painting explores themes of love, desire, and forbidden romance.
